Mike Rus, PGA General Manager Michael Rus has been a PGA member since 1994 with over 35 years of experience in golf club management. Mike began in the golf industry at the age of 13 when he started working at his local municipal course while growing up in New Mexico. He landed his first Head Golf Professional position immediately upon completing his education at Arizona State University. In 2009 he joined Touchstone Golf and has managed semi-private, public and resort facilities. Mike has a proven track record for creating operational efficiencies with improved financial performances at golf properties in Northern California, Colorado and Arizona. He is experienced in all aspects of golf operations management including golf business start-ups, food & beverage operations, course maintenance, membership services, indoor golf simulators, and golf course design. Golf Lessons in Chandler — Common Questions

How much do golf lessons cost in Chandler?

Prices vary by format and instructor experience. As a general guide:

  • Private (1-on-1): $75–$175 per hour
  • Group clinics: $25–$60 per person
  • Junior lessons: $40–$80 per session
  • Playing lessons (on-course): $150–$250+
  • Lesson packages: 10–20% off single-lesson rates

Always ask about package pricing before booking.

What certifications should I look for in a golf instructor in Chandler?

PGA of America certification is the gold standard. Also look for LPGA Teaching Division, TPI (Titleist Performance Institute), and USGTF credentials.

How many golf lessons do I need as a beginner?

Most beginners need 6–10 lessons before feeling comfortable playing a full round. Lessons 1–2 focus on grip, stance, and basic mechanics. By lessons 3–5 you'll add chipping and putting. A solid beginner package typically costs $400–$800 total.

Are there junior golf lessons available in Chandler?

Yes — many instructors in Chandler offer junior-specific programs and group clinics. Junior lessons typically run $40–$80 per session.
